Cash withdrawals from bank do not attract Section 269ST Penalty

April 5, 2017 57885 Views 10 comments Print

It has also been decided that the restriction on cash transaction under section 269ST shall not apply to withdrawal of cash from a bank, co­operative bank or a post office savings bank.

Capital Gain Taxability – Joint Development Agreements (JDA) – whether all issues are addressed in budget 2017?

April 5, 2017 6582 Views 0 comment Print

Prior to Finance Bill 2017 in case of JDA arrangement capital gains is chargeable to tax in the year in which transfer takes place. H’ble Courts have ruled that granting possession vide execution of agreement is part performance of contract which confers developer with the right over the property & therefore tantamount to transfer u/s 2(47) of Act

Requirement to quote Aadhaar in ITR not applicable to Non Resident

April 5, 2017 5007 Views 0 comment Print

Section 139AA of the Income-tax Act, 1961 as introduced by the Finance Act, 2017 provides for mandatory quoting of Aadhaar / Enrolment ID of Aadhaar application form, for filing of return of income and for making an application for allotment of Permanent Account Number with effect from 1st July, 2017.

Profit increased due to disallowance U/s. 40(a)(ia) is eligible for deduction U/s. 10A

April 5, 2017 2721 Views 0 comment Print

It cannot be denied that expenditure incurred by the assessee for the purpose of developing housing project and not allowable by virtue of section 40(a)(ia) would ultimately go to increase assessee’s profit from such business and profit as computed after making the dis allowance would, therefore, qualify for deduction under section 10A.

Govt allows duty free Import of 5 Lakh MT raw sugar under TRQ

April 5, 2017 1017 Views 0 comment Print

Import of 5 Lakh MT of raw sugar under Exim Code 170114 of Chapter 17 of ITC (HS), 2017–Schedule–I (Import Policy) is allowed duty free under TRQ.
